Mayor resigns, says health and family influenced decision

Mayor resigns, says health and family influenced decision

Citing health concerns and the wish to spend more time with family, Lac La Biche County Mayor Peter Kirylchuk resigned on June 19 after nearly eight years in office-forcing a by-election within the next 90 days.

Federal government forces closure of local youth centre

Federal government forces closure of local youth centre

For the second year in a row, a disappointing move by the federal government forced the Lac La Biche Canadian Native Friendship Centre to lay off staff and shutter the popular New Horizons Youth Centre.
Your council could soon serve four-year terms

Your council could soon serve four-year terms

Depending on the results of a government review, municipal politicians could soon serve four year terms instead of the usual three. The extended time in office is just one of a host of changes that Muni­cipal Affairs is considering for the province.
